An organization is implementing an AI/ML model for credit approval decisions subject to regulatory oversight. Which TWO of the following are the most significant risk considerations?

- ✓
Model bias causing discriminatory outcomes
Why this is correct
Bias can lead to legal and reputational damage.
- ✓
Model explainability for regulatory compliance
Why this is correct
Regulators may require clear explanations for credit decisions.
- ✗
Data privacy in AI training
Why it's wrong here
Important but secondary to bias and explainability in regulated decisions.
- ✗
High computational cost of model retraining
Why it's wrong here
Cost is an operational concern, not a risk for regulatory compliance.
- ✗
Adversarial attacks on the training data
Why it's wrong here
While a risk, it is less immediate than bias and explainability for credit approval.
